First thank you for your comment!
Yea I absolutely understand that point. However from an artist point of view I based this weapon on parts of the original STAR WARS X-Wing design and one of the nice details of the film was that the stuff the rebels had was worren off - basically used old stuff - compared to the shiny factory new Empire things. It boils down to basic visual story telling: evil guys own good new stuff vs good guys have to fight with what they have left.
to sum it up: The weapon design is a combination of the storm trooper black + white scheme and the X-Wing space ship design - and should feel 70`s - 80`s science fictionish (as requested for the constes) all combined with the ALIEN "metal melting blood thingy". The weapon at all states should feel like it could belong into both franchise.
